Abstract

In this paper a method for automatic detection of Micro-aneurysms in digital angiograms of the eye fundus is described. These lesions of the human retina, a characteristic of the earliest phases of diabetic retinopathy, present themselves in the angiographic images as small, round, hyper-fluorescent objects. The proposed method includes initial pre-processing and enhancement steps, followed by object segmentation. In the final phase, micro-aneurysms are validated using two new criteria based on local intensity, contrast and shape relations. The combination of these local features with global image parameters makes possible a high degree of independence from image intensity characteristics.
